This project is destined to be the most used sweater in everyone’s handmade wardrobe this season! Utilizing a textured or boucle yarn, a sherpa-like fabric is created. In tandem with clever construction techniques, the finished project will look just like your favorite on-trend fleeces. Crocheted top down with a raglan style construction, the zipper is sewn on afterward and the optional furry texture is created after finishing by brushing the fabric with a fiber brush.

This plaid blanket is made of individual squares which are seamed together using the mattress stitch. The squares are made of herringbone half double crochet – a fun and modern twist on the standard HDC stitch. The design uses worsted weight yarn and is finished with fringe along the short sides.

This multipurpose tote allows you to wear it as a shoulder or a handbag, depending on the strap length you choose. It includes a small detachable pocket to easily access your essentials, and a couple of decorative pom-poms made with left-over yarn. The size allows one to carry a 13” computer, without being too big to look like a shopping bag.
